Product profile
UTP Sodium Salt is classified as nucleotide or nucleotide analog (Formula C9H12N2Na3O15P3; molecular weight 550.09).
UTP Sodium Salt can support enzyme-substrate, in-vitro transcription, polymerase-screening or analytical-reference studies as appropriate to its phosphate state.
For UTP Sodium Salt, reported solubility: H₂O: soluble at 25 mg of UTP in 0.5 ml of solvent, clear, colorless. Storage: −20°C.

Physicochemical data
| Key chemistry motifs | triphosphate group |
|---|---|
| CAS context | The listed CAS refers to the parent/free-acid identity; confirm the supplied salt or counterion in the current specification. |
| Melting point | 140 °C |
| Form | Powder |
| Color | White |
| SMILES | O[C@@H]1[C@@H]([C@@H](COP(O)(=O)OP(O)(=O)OP(O)(O)=O)O[C@H]1N1C=CC(=O)NC1=O)O.[NaH] |&1:1,2,3,19,r| |
| InChIKey | IKVGSWYKOMJBSB-RFFBCSJBNA-N |
| InChI | InChI=1S/C9H15N2O15P3.3Na/c12-5-1-2-11(9(15)10-5)8-7(14)6(13)4(24-8)3-23-28(19,20)26-29(21,22)25-27(16,17)18;;;/h1-2,4,6-8,13-14H,3H2,(H,19,20)(H,21,22)(H,10,12,15)(H2,16,17,18);;;/q;3*+1/p-3/t4-,6-,7-,8-;;;/m.../s |
